Hmm HD33 vs 3010 is a bit of a tough decision but I think based of the reviews & ur particular needs it can be decided as below

1)Lighting conditions:- If you dont have a dedicated darkened HT room & plan to use the projector in a normal room then Epson is the clear winner...

2) 2D vs 3D:- If you watch a lot of 3D content then HD33 might be a better choice even though epson is brighter in 3D mode... If you are mainly gonna use for 2D then epson wins on that front...

3) Price :- If you buy both with warranty I believe the best price for epson is 95K where as HD33 is around 1.25-1.35 lacs... Without bill I would not recommend unless someone is gonna carry it for you from the US & avoid customs... On this front again Epson is the clear winner...

Also while negotiating make sure you buy with 2 3D glasses in the range of 1.04-1.07Lacs coz they normally charge 13k for 2x3D Glasses... Both of these projectors are 3d ready, those do not work ootb with 3d Bluray/media player. You need to either use HTPC or a 3D box like Optoma 3DXL. Remember to factor that in your cost.
